  • How to pin down a person from a photo?
    The main problem with metadata is that it is often erased by broad editors, making it impossible to disclose information about a person. And the fact that almost everyone uses editors, that is why there is no chance to read them. In addition, EXIF ​​is very easy to erase or change on your own using exifpurge.com, so it is impossible to fully verify this search method. Source: about 2 years ago
  • [Fanfiction] How a tumblr blog resulted in mass exodus of authors and real addresses being leaked.
    For tools, on PC, the go-to tools has been EXIF Purge, and there are several tools on both App Store and Play Store (I use Imagepipe). Samsung (and Google Camera, apparently) allows disabling location tags in their camera app, though if you don't trust them and find its result to be OK, then you can use Open Camera instead.
